Index: content/browser/renderer_host/render_widget_host_view_mac.mm |
diff --git a/content/browser/renderer_host/render_widget_host_view_mac.mm b/content/browser/renderer_host/render_widget_host_view_mac.mm |
index 00e46429c5addafcc61ecee4fc5b74f35bcda59e..b0699d75510e9ab5bbcca6d8293594166c2a049b 100644 |
--- a/content/browser/renderer_host/render_widget_host_view_mac.mm |
+++ b/content/browser/renderer_host/render_widget_host_view_mac.mm |
@@ -2272,7 +2272,8 @@ void RenderWidgetHostViewMac::SetTextInputActive(bool active) { |
// smaller and the renderer hasn't yet repainted. |
int yOffset = NSHeight([self bounds]) - backingStore->size().height(); |
- gfx::Rect paintRect = bitmapRect.Intersect(damagedRect); |
+ gfx::Rect paintRect = bitmapRect; |
+ paintRect.Intersect(damagedRect); |
if (!paintRect.IsEmpty()) { |
// if we have a CGLayer, draw that into the window |
if (backingStore->cg_layer()) { |